Medications to Avoid Before ESWL

Please review the following list of medications prior to your procedure at The Stone Center of New Jersey. You should discontinue use of these medications according to the minimum time requirement outlined below. If you have a question about any other medications, please call The Stone Center at 862-235-1983.

If you are taking Coumadin, Lovenox, Fragmin or Arixtra please contact your prescribing Physician immediately and make him/her aware of our request to discontinue this medication prior to your scheduled procedure.

In addition to the medications listed below, there are many other products on the market, including many vitamins and supplements that may interfere with the blood’s ability to clot. We recommend that you check with your doctor or pharmacist if you have a question as to whether your medication, vitamin, or supplement contain aspirin or may interfere with the blood’s ability to clot.

DO NOT STOP TAKING ANY PRESCRIBED MEDICATIONS WITHOUT FIRST CHECKING WITH YOUR PHYSICIAN

Discontinue 5 Days prior to treatment: Brand name followed by generic in parentheses

  • Brilinta (Ticagrelor – Generic)
  • Effient (Prasugrel – Generic)
  • Plavix (Clopidogrel – Generic)

Discontinue 4 Days prior to treatment: Brand name followed by generic in parentheses

  • Aleve, Naprosyn, Naprelan (Naproxen)
  • Persantine  (Dipyridamole)
  • (Cilostazol) Only generic
  • Treximet (Sumatriptan/Naproxen)
  • Mobic, Qamzovz, Xifyrm, (Meloxicam)

Discontinue 3 Days prior to treatment: Brand name followed by generic in parentheses

  • Celebrex (Celcoxib)     
  • Xarelto (Rivarobaxan)
  • (Diflunisal) Only generic
  • (Ketoprofen) Only generic
  • Eliquis (Apixaban)

Discontinue 2 Days prior to treatment: Brand name followed by generic in parentheses

  • Advil, Motrin, Nuprin (Ibuprofen)
  • Agrylin (Anagrelide)
  • (Diclofenac) Only generic
  • Elmiron (Pentosan Polysulfate)
  • (Fenoprofen) Only generic
  • Flector Patch(Diclofenac Patch)
  • (Flurbiprofen) Only generic
  • (Indomethacin) Only generic
  • Toradol (Ketorolac)
  • Meclomen (Meclofenamate)
  • Midol Complete (Acetaminophen/ASA/Caffeine) Voltaren Gel (Diclofenac Gel)
  • Pennsaid Solution, Solaraze Gel, (Topical Diclofenac)
  • Ponstel (Mefenamic Acid)
  • Pradaxa (Dabigatran)

  • (Sulindac) Only generic

  • Voltaren (Diclofenac)

  • Voltaren Gel (Diclofenac Gel)
